Kenansville, FL (January 18, 2025) – A vehicle crash with injuries occurred late Friday evening on Florida’s Turnpike NB (SR-91 NB) near mile marker 205.5 in Osceola County. Emergency responders were dispatched at 10:36 p.m. to address the situation.
Although details about the arrival time of first responders are currently unavailable, medics and fire crews from Osceola County are actively working to assist individuals hurt in the crash. Fortunately, the incident did not result in any roadblock, allowing traffic to flow through the area. At this time, specifics regarding the number of vehicles involved and the extent of injuries have not been disclosed. Authorities continue to investigate the cause of the accident and will release updates as new information becomes available.

Vehicle Accidents on Florida’s Turnpike
Florida’s Turnpike (SR-91) is a critical transportation route that serves residents and travelers alike, spanning numerous counties, including Osceola. Accidents on this roadway are often caused by common factors such as speeding, distracted driving, and vehicle malfunction. In rural areas like Kenansville, reduced visibility and long stretches of uninterrupted highway can contribute to driver fatigue, increasing the likelihood of crashes.
The Florida Department of Highway Safety and Motor Vehicles (FLHSMV) regularly emphasizes the importance of safe driving practices, especially on high-speed routes like the turnpike. Efforts to reduce accidents include increased patrol presence and educational campaigns to promote awareness among drivers.
